Client company of Coral Capital Partners. New NRG was a publicly traded, start up company building a biodiesel refinery in Washington state. Successfully located an investment bank and secured a letter of intent for a $10 million secondary offering. Became company President in March of 2007. The company had not filed reports with the Securities Exchange Commission in several years. Brought the company current in its filings with the SEC in October of 2007.

Client company of Coral Capital Partners. AP Henderson Group was a publicly traded company on the OTC Bulletin Board. I was appointed President and a member of the Board of Directors for the purposes of investigating fraud involving a merger with a Chinese company, and devising and implementing a restructuring strategy. During this period of time I was responsible for overseeing the company's audit and filings with the Securities Exchange Commission.

Client company of Coral Capital Partners. I was the sole US based Officer & Director. Nocera, Inc. was an Italian food processing company that was publicly traded on the NASD OTC market. The company maintained manufacturing facilities in Italy and Uruguay. The company had approximately 250 shareholders outside of the United States. Lead the investigation of acts of securities fraud committed by several previous officers and directors of the company. Developed and oversaw the legal action against the former officers and directors for damages resulting from their securities fraud. Successfully recovered the damages awarded by the US Federal Court. Successfully defended company in the appeal by former management to the 9th Circuit Court of Appeals.
